网络流量实时监测有哪些技术手段?
随着互联网技术的飞速发展,网络流量实时监测已成为保障网络安全、优化网络性能的重要手段。本文将深入探讨网络流量实时监测的技术手段,旨在为相关从业者提供有益的参考。
一、概述
网络流量实时监测是指对网络中的数据传输进行实时监控,以获取网络运行状态、性能指标等信息。其主要目的是保障网络安全、提高网络服务质量、优化网络资源配置。以下是几种常见的网络流量实时监测技术手段。
二、技术手段
- 流量分析技术
流量分析技术是网络流量实时监测的基础,通过对网络数据包的捕获、分析,实现对网络流量的监控。主要技术包括:
- 数据包捕获:利用网络接口卡或专门的流量捕获设备,实时捕获网络中的数据包。
- 数据包解析:对捕获到的数据包进行解析,提取出关键信息,如源IP、目的IP、端口号等。
- 流量统计:根据解析后的数据,统计网络流量、带宽利用率等指标。
- 深度包检测(Deep Packet Inspection,DPI)技术
深度包检测技术能够对网络数据包进行深度分析,识别数据包中的应用层信息,实现对特定应用的流量控制。其主要技术包括:
- 协议识别:识别数据包所使用的协议,如HTTP、FTP、SMTP等。
- 应用识别:根据协议识别结果,进一步识别具体的应用,如网页浏览、文件传输、邮件等。
- 流量控制:对特定应用的流量进行控制,如限制带宽、封堵恶意流量等。
- 流量预测技术
流量预测技术通过对历史流量数据的分析,预测未来一段时间内的网络流量变化趋势。主要技术包括:
- 时间序列分析:分析历史流量数据的时间序列变化规律,预测未来流量。
- 机器学习:利用机器学习算法,如神经网络、支持向量机等,对流量数据进行训练和预测。
- 可视化技术
可视化技术将网络流量数据以图形、图表等形式直观展示,便于用户理解网络运行状态。主要技术包括:
- 实时图表:实时展示网络流量、带宽利用率等指标。
- 拓扑图:展示网络设备、链路等信息,直观展示网络结构。
- 流量地图:展示全球或特定区域的网络流量分布情况。
三、案例分析
以某企业网络为例,该企业采用深度包检测技术对网络流量进行实时监测。通过分析,发现以下问题:
- 某部门员工大量使用P2P软件,导致网络带宽利用率过高,影响其他部门正常办公。
- 某部门存在大量恶意流量,对网络安全造成威胁。
针对以上问题,企业采取以下措施:
- 对P2P流量进行限制,保障网络带宽。
- 对恶意流量进行封堵,提高网络安全。
通过实时监测和针对性措施,企业有效提高了网络性能和安全性。
四、总结
网络流量实时监测是保障网络安全、优化网络性能的重要手段。本文介绍了流量分析、深度包检测、流量预测和可视化等常见技术手段,并结合实际案例,分析了网络流量实时监测的应用。希望对相关从业者有所帮助。
猜你喜欢:全栈链路追踪